Mountain biking in Sandlau offers a diverse network of trails primarily situated around the forest areas of Bezirk Tulln. The region is characterized by its relatively flat terrain with gentle elevation changes, making it accessible for various skill levels. Riders can expect routes that follow riverbanks, traverse open fields, and wind through wooded sections. The landscape provides a mix of natural paths and well-maintained tracks suitable for mountain biking.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many mountain bike trails are available in Sandlau?

Sandlau features a comprehensive network of over 200 mountain bike trails. These routes are primarily situated around the forest areas of Bezirk Tulln, offering diverse options for riders.

What kind of terrain can I expect on mountain bike trails in Sandlau?

The region is characterized by relatively flat terrain with gentle elevation changes, making it accessible for various skill levels. You'll find routes that follow riverbanks, traverse open fields, and wind through wooded sections, providing a mix of natural paths and well-maintained tracks.

Are there easy mountain bike trails suitable for beginners or families in Sandlau?

Yes, Sandlau has a good selection of easy trails. There are 49 easy routes available, perfect for beginners or family outings. An example is the Last Kamp Bridge – View over the Danube loop from Grafenwörth, which is 20.9 miles (33.7 km) long and offers scenic views.

Are there any challenging mountain bike routes in Sandlau?

While the region is generally characterized by gentle terrain, there are 6 routes classified as difficult for those seeking more of a challenge. The majority of trails, 161 to be exact, fall into the moderate difficulty category, offering a good balance for experienced riders.

What is the best time of year to go mountain biking in Sandlau?

The best time for mountain biking in Sandlau is typically from spring through autumn (April to October) when the weather is mild and trails are dry. During these months, the riverine landscapes and forested sections are particularly enjoyable. Winter riding might be possible on some routes, but conditions can be variable due to snow or ice.

What are some scenic highlights or attractions along the mountain bike trails in Sandlau?

Many routes offer scenic views over the Danube and pass by interesting points. You might encounter attractions such as the Altenwörth fish pass, the Last Kamp Bridge, or the Swan Idyll. These highlights provide great spots for a break or to enjoy the local environment.

Are there mountain bike trails that form a loop in Sandlau?

Yes, many mountain bike trails in Sandlau are designed as loops, offering convenient starting and ending points. For instance, the Wayside shrine – Last Kamp Bridge loop from Grafenwörth is an easy 14.0-mile (22.6 km) loop that takes about 1 hour 9 minutes to complete.

How long do mountain bike trails in Sandlau typically take to complete?

Trail durations vary significantly based on distance and difficulty. For example, the Regentag Ship – Tulln Main Square loop from Altenwörth is a moderate 29.2-mile (47.1 km) trail that typically takes about 2 hours 26 minutes, while shorter, easier routes like the Last Kamp Bridge – Altenwörth fish pass loop from Grafenwörth (11.3 miles / 18.1 km) can be completed in just over an hour.

Is it possible to access mountain bike trails in Sandlau using public transport?

Sandlau and the surrounding Bezirk Tulln region are generally well-connected by public transport, including train and bus services that can bring you close to various trailheads. It's advisable to check local public transport schedules and bike carriage policies for specific routes and starting points.
